Erb's Palsy can occur when doctors pull too forcefully on a baby's head arms or neck during vaginal delivery or a C-section. The result is that the baby's neck or head can be stretched, or even tear the nerves in the brachial nerve, which control the movement and sensation of the arm. It is usually caused by a difficult birth or a birth that is breech, and can be prevented with the right medical treatment. Some babies recover from this injury on their own while others are permanently disabled. The brachialplexus comprises a collection of nerves that provides sensation and coordination to the muscles of your arm. Any forceful stretching or pulling on the shoulder, head or arms that stretch these nerves could cause damage and lead to an injury like Erb's palsy. In some cases the injuries are only temporary and may be improved through therapy. In some instances, the injury may be permanent and cause severe impact on your child. While obstetricians have been trained to recognize the risk of shoulder dystocia, and take the appropriate precautions during labor, this condition can still occur. In fact it's estimated that approximately 50% of cases involving brachial plexus injuries are due to simple vaginal births.
